That's not quite true. He can't insist they sign with SyCo, he can only stop them from releasing material during a specific period after the show ends.
Rebecca could decline to sign a recording deal with SyCo and sign immediately with someone else. But she wouldn't be allowed to release any material or promote herself outside of the X Factor for a set period in the contract signed at the beginning of the lives shows.
Whether she'd do that is another matter. If Simon wants to sign her, he will make an offer, which she may well accept.

The main problem with Joe has been the disparity between his style and image on the show and the style of his album and new look.
Contestants are often criticised for churning out an album of ballads but this is one occasion when that is exactly what a contestant's fanbase was expecting and hoping for. Instead they got a record that though very in keeping with the current trend of 80s synth pop and 70s glam rock, has an air of Mika and Scissor Sisters lite which is at odds with the image of Joe from the show.
If you're going to put out an album like that, you have to go the whole hog with the image. Firstly, I don't think Joe has the sass or the confidence to pull that off anyway but secondly, many of his fans have enough of a problem with the new musical style and the new haircut and clothes. If he strutted on looking like the reincarnation of Marc Bolan, he'd probably lose the rest of them.
